Current status and operator

Status: Closed / historical. Operator: historical brand owner reported: 8Ball Games Limited; historical licensed operator: Cassava Enterprises (Gibraltar) Limited; confidence: secondary ownership source plus authoritative Gibraltar licence list.

The current destination and brand identity no longer present Sparkling Bingo as the same standalone service.

What the historical product offered

Sparkling Bingo is associated with the following formats or product labels. Room schedules and network catalogues can change:

  • historically 75-ball and 90-ball
  • slots/instant games

Other documented characteristics include glitter/sparkle visual theme, mobile-web play promoted by 2013, 24/7 support historically advertised, networked bingo. Shared-network features should not be mistaken for games unique to this skin.

Drawbacks and limitations

  • No authoritative closure date found.
  • Do not infer current 888 ownership merely because the trading name remains in an old licensing PDF.

The largest limitation is final: Sparkling Bingo is not a current destination. Old bonuses, room timetables and product details should not be treated as current.
